Activities & Mission

Deal Area Foodbank & Pantry provides emergency food aid to individuals and families located in Deal and the surrounding villages including Sandwich & Aylsham. Donated food is taken to a warehouse for storage and stock control measures. Clients attend local distribution points to exchange a voucher issued by one of over 30 agencies and partner organisations for a 3 day emergency supply of food.
